HANNIGAN, Emma Denise

This was published in the following publications on 04.03.2018:
Irish Times

HANNIGAN Emma Denise (Bray, Co. Wicklow), March 3, 2018. Peacefully, at Blackrock Clinic, in loving care of The Nightingale Oncology Team. Her husband Cian, children Sacha and Kim, loving parents Philip and Denise, brother Timmy, sister-in-law Hilary and extended family mourn the loss of the light of our lives. Funeral service in Our Lady of Perpetual Succour Church, Foxrock, Dublin 18, on Wednesday, (March 7), at 11.30am, followed by burial in Shanganagh Cemetery, Shankill. Family flowers only.
